🦊CVFox
Was ist

Whiteboard-Interview?

Einfache Erklärung

Stellen Sie sich ein Whiteboard-Interview wie eine Herausforderung in einer Kochshow vor. Sie sollen ein Gericht zubereiten, aber Sie dürfen keine Rezepte oder ausgefallenen Geräte verwenden – nur Ihre Fähigkeiten und ein Schneidebrett. Für Softwareingenieure ist es ähnlich. Sie stehen vor einem Gremium und lösen Programmieraufgaben nur mit einem Marker und einem leeren Board. Keine Computer, nur Ihr Gehirn ist gefragt. Das ist wichtig, weil es zeigt, wie Sie spontan denken. Wie ein Koch, der erklärt, warum er eine Prise Salz hinzufügt, sprechen Sie über Ihre Programmierentscheidungen. Es geht nicht darum, sofort die perfekte Antwort zu haben. Es geht darum, Ihren Problemlösungsprozess zu zeigen, genau wie ein Koch zeigt, wie er kocht, bevor er sein Gericht serviert.

Ausführliche Erklärung

Definition

Ein Whiteboard-Interview ist eine technische Bewertungsmethode, bei der Kandidaten Programmier- oder Systemdesignprobleme auf einem Whiteboard oder einem geteilten Bildschirm lösen. Dieses Format wird häufig in Softwareingenieurrollen verwendet, um Problemlösungs- und Kommunikationsfähigkeiten zu bewerten.

Wie es funktioniert

  1. 1Setup: Kandidaten erhalten ein Problem, das sie in einem Besprechungsraum oder über ein virtuelles Whiteboard-Tool lösen sollen.
  2. 2Problemlösung: Sie schreiben Code oder entwerfen Systeme, während sie ihre Überlegungen erklären.
  3. 3Interaktion: Interviewer stellen Fragen, um Verständnis und Herangehensweise zu beurteilen.
  4. 4Bewertung: Die Leistung wird anhand von Genauigkeit, Effizienz und Klarheit der Gedanken bewertet.

Hauptmerkmale

  • Konzentriert sich auf Problemlösungsfähigkeiten.
  • Erfordert verbale Erklärung der Denkprozesse.
  • Bewertet Codierungssyntax und Logik ohne Computerunterstützung.

Vergleich

AspektWhiteboard-InterviewOnline-Coding-Test
OrtPersönlich/VirtualOnline
InteraktionEchtzeit-FeedbackVerzögertes Feedback
WerkzeugeWhiteboard/MarkerIDE/Computer
BewertungskriterienProblemlösung, KommunikationCodekorrektheit, Stil

Praxisbeispiel

Bei Technologieriesen wie Google und Amazon sind Whiteboard-Interviews Standard, um die Fähigkeit der Kandidaten zu bewerten, komplexe algorithmische Probleme zu lösen und Lösungen effektiv zu kommunizieren.

Beste Praktiken

  • Regelmäßig üben: Nutzen Sie Plattformen wie LeetCode oder HackerRank, um Probleme zu simulieren.
  • Laut denken: Artikulieren Sie klar Ihren Denkprozess, während Sie arbeiten.
  • Strukturieren Sie Ihre Antwort: Zerlegen Sie das Problem in kleinere, handhabbare Teile, bevor Sie mit dem Codieren beginnen.

Häufige Missverständnisse

  • "Es geht nur darum, die richtige Antwort zu bekommen."
- Realität: Methodik und Kommunikation sind ebenso wichtig wie Genauigkeit.
  • "Man muss alle Algorithmen auswendig lernen."
- Realität: Verständnis und Anwendung sind wichtiger als Auswendiglernen.
  • "Whiteboard-Fähigkeiten werden in echten Jobs nicht genutzt."
- Realität: Die getesteten Fähigkeiten spiegeln reale Problemlösungs- und Kooperationsfähigkeiten wider.

Verwandte Begriffe

Technisches InterviewCoding-TestSystemdesign-InterviewAlgorithmusDatenstrukturPair Programming